I semi-bartend. I would say Gin would mix well with Lemon based drinks.
E.g. Mix your Gin with some Lemon and Lime Soda, Sweet & Sour (It's a mixer), splash(es) of Lemon and splash(es) of Lime. You'd end with a Lemonade type drink.
Could even try adding a little Pomegranate Liquer if you wanted to give it a red/pink color along with some White Canberry & Peach juice as well as Peach Schnapps and Triple Sec.
So all in all:
-Lemonade-ish Drink:
-Gin
-Sweet & Sour
-Lemon and Lime Soda
-Lemon Juice (A couple splashes depending on volume)
-Lime Juice (A couple splashes depending on volume)
-Pink Lemonade-type drink:
-All of the above
-White Cranberry with Peach Juice
-Pomegranate Liquer (Bols makes a cheap version, used for coloring primarily)
-Triple Sec
-Peach Schnapps
I've tried both of these before and are big hits when I throw parties. Generally people request the second mix more. Also, if you end up not using the gin, this works REALLY well with Rum.
